Most types of frozen raw or cooked clams will keep for two months if the freezer is set at 0°F or colder. Be sure to thaw frozen clams in the refrigerator, not at room temperature. Retain the clam liquor or juice for use in soups and sauces for additional flavor. • 6 to 12 clams = 1 serving. • 1 quart unshucked = 1 serving steamed. • 8 quarts unshelled = 1 quart shucked. • 1 quart shucked = 6 servings. • 1 quart shucked = 2 to 3 cups chopped. • 1 pint shucked = 3 to 4 servings.

Place the scrubbed clams in the salted water to soak for 15 minutes, which will draw out the sand. Remove the clams to a colander and drain the water from the pot. Rinse out the pot. Fill the pot or bowl once more with salted water and soak the clams again for 15 minutes. Drain and rinse the clams before steaming them.

Top Neck and Cherry Stone Clams Topnecks, approximately 6-9/lb. and cherrystones about 4-5/lb. are larger clams great for eating raw or used for clams casino.The largest clams are called quahogs or chowder clams. Weighing in at a mighty 2-3 clams per pound, quahogs are used in such dishes as clam chowder, stuffed clams and clam fritters.
